For decades, filmmakers didn’t have the luxury of a computer generating entire worlds. They had to get really creative with what they could physically build and manipulate. We’re talking about practical effects, the stuff you can touch, feel, and sometimes even smell on set. Think about King Kong in the 1933 film. That wasn’t a computer model; it was a 18-inch tall model meticulously animated frame by frame. It took months of painstaking work, but the result was groundbreaking for its time.

Then came the big shift. The advent of computer-generated imagery, or CGI, started changing the game in the late 1980s and especially the 1990s. Suddenly, you could create things that were impossible to build in real life. Jurassic Park, released in 1993, is a prime example. While it still used some impressive animatronics, the dinosaurs were largely brought to life with early CGI. It was revolutionary, opening up a universe of possibilities for filmmakers and blowing audiences away. I remember seeing it for the first time and being absolutely convinced those creatures were real. It truly felt like the future had arrived.

Of course, practical effects didn’t just vanish overnight. For a long time, it was a blend. Take Star Wars (the original trilogy, specifically). Those starships and alien creatures were a masterclass in miniatures, matte paintings, and stop-motion animation. The Millennium Falcon dogfights were achieved through incredibly detailed scale models filmed against black backdrops. It gave those early sci-fi films a tangible, gritty feel that, frankly, some modern CGI can sometimes lack. The sheer ingenuity involved in creating practical illusions is astounding.

The cost of CGI can also be a massive hurdle. While it might seem like digital effects are cheaper than building massive sets or complex machinery, that’s not always the case. A few seconds of high-quality CGI can cost hundreds of thousands, even millions of dollars. Think about rendering farms, specialized software, and the teams of artists needed to create believable digital assets. It’s not as simple as just pressing a button. On the flip side, a well-executed practical effect, like a meticulously crafted prosthetic, might only cost a fraction of that, especially if it can be reused.

The sheer amount of detail that can go into practical effects is incredible. For The Lord of the Rings trilogy, they created an entire Middle-earth with practical costumes, weapons, and even scale models of cities like Minas Tirith. The orc suits were elaborate prosthetics, and the sheer number of extras in those battle scenes lent a weight and chaos that CGI armies sometimes struggle to replicate authentically. The sheer number of different disciplines involved in practical effects – from sculpting and mold-making to pyrotechnics and rigging – is mind-boggling.

Nowadays, it’s really a hybrid approach that dominates. Filmmakers use CGI to augment and enhance practical elements, creating a seamless blend. Think about The Martian. The landscapes of Mars were heavily reliant on CGI, but the rover, Mark Watney’s habitat, and the detailed costumes were all practical builds. This combination allows for both the grand spectacle of digital worlds and the grounded reality of physical sets and props. It’s about finding that sweet spot where the technology serves the story.
